A lithium-ion battery typically has a life cycle ranging from 500 to 2,000 charge cycles, depending on the type and usage frequency. Each cycle refers to a complete discharge followed by a full charge. Over time, internal chemical reactions can cause a decline in battery performance.
After one year, it's essential to understand where the battery stands in its life cycle, especially if it has been used consistently. Many users wonder if their battery’s efficiency has diminished. Factors such as temperature, charging habits, and depth of discharge can directly influence their longevity.

To assess whether a one-year-old lithium-ion battery is still effective, it’s vital to measure its health. Many devices have built-in diagnostics that can provide battery health information. For instance, software on smartphones often displays the percentage of battery capacity relative to its original capacity.
A battery that still retains about 80% of its original capacity after one year of regular use is generally considered healthy. However, if it drops below this threshold, users might start experiencing shorter runtimes and slower device performance.

It's essential not only to care for your lithium-ion batteries but also to understand their environmental impact. Recycling these batteries is crucial for reducing waste and recovering valuable materials. Many retailers and manufacturers now offer recycling programs. Responsible disposal helps prevent toxic materials from harming the environment.
